Seeking an experienced professional in learning design and development to join our team as a Global Jobs & Skills Architecture Consultant, Assistant Director
The opportunity
Working for the Global Jobs & Skills Architecture Lead, this role will work to continuously improve and maintain an enterprise-wide skills taxonomy and job architecture, working closely with senior business leaders, our Skills Management vendors and with Talent. The role will lead, design and deliver on technology enablement of the job and skills architecture, including designing AI agents to manage a variety of processes, and prompt engineering to support review and manipulation of large datasets. The role will consider how changes to skills and the job architecture will impact downstream processes incl: recruitment, reward, learning, workforce planning and resource management, and work across Talent functions at global and region level to ensure the changes are understood and implemented effectively.
